(<a title="franchise disputes" href="http://www.franworst.com" target="_blank">Franchising&#8217;s Worst Case Scenarios</a>) The lively dispute between Anthony &#8220;Cousin Vinny&#8221; Agnello and Subway franchisor Doctor&#8217;s Associates, Inc. holds important lessons for both franchisors and prospective franchisees.</p>
<p>Prospective franchisees:  If you are a maverick and a rulebreaker, don&#8217;t buy a franchise.</p>
<p>Franchisors:  If your prospect is a maverick and a rulebreaker, don&#8217;t award him a franchise.  Especially if he&#8217;s a pimp and strip club operator with &#8220;an arrest record that stretches from here to Timbuktu.&#8221;</p>
<p>According to a story on franchise site <a href="http://www.bluemaumau.org/5643/subway_terminates_franchise_owner_lewd_marketing" target="_blank">Blue Mau Mau</a>, Vinny Agnello has a shady and well-publicized history that includes providing a stripper to a group of under-aged high school boys and multiple arrests for providing prostitutes, including a 17-year-old girl.  Not the silent type, Cousin Vinny has been on CNN, Fox News and others, &#8220;ridiculing his detractors as being sexually repressed and hypocritical.&#8221;</p>
<p><strong>Cousin Vinny attempts to &#8220;go legit.&#8221;</strong></p>
<p>In 2007, according to BMM, Cousin Vinny Agnello decided to branch out into a legit business buy getting a Subway franchise for the Bronx, which he financed with the proceeds of his stripping and escort businesses.</p>
<blockquote><p>Mr. Agnello describes how Doctor&#8217;s Associates Inc., the company who operates the Subway chain&#8230;failed to investigate his business background or criminal record. “Imagine that a guy like me can sneak into Corporate America,” he says. “I have an arrest record that stretches from here to Timbuktu.&#8221;</p>
<p>All went well until the end of his initial training session last year. Caught up in the spirit of graduating at a cocktail party, Vinny says he passed out business cards of his strippers for the enjoyment of his classmates and Doctor&#8217;s Associates staff. He notes that the Subway sandwich chain&#8217;s CEO, Mr. Fred DeLuca was in attendance.</p>
<p>“The next day they said it was a moral violation and they escorted me off the grounds,” says Mr. Agnello. According to him, Doctor&#8217;s Associates, Inc. relented. He could be an owner-operator if he signed a morals agreement. Firms require the signing of a morals agreement or clause to strengthen termination when they anticipate that a franchise owner could cause public embarrassment to the firm.</p>
<p>Vinny states he was specifically instructed to not promote strip clubs or lewd services at a Subway restaurant or function.</p></blockquote>
<p><strong>Cousin Vinny&#8217;s creative decor and marketing contributions not appreciated.</strong></p>
<p>McDonald&#8217;s franchisees contributed such ideas as Ronald McDonald, the Filet o&#8217; Fish and Chicken McNuggets.  Cousin Vinny&#8217;s innovative contributions to Subway, which included in-store posters for sex dolls, were not quite as well received.  According to BMM:</p>
<blockquote><p>This year a representative of the company visited Vinny&#8217;s Subway restaurant in May. His restaurant walls had posters of sex dolls, nude dancing services and memorabilia of Mr. Agnello&#8217;s own colorful media history. At first he was given a 60-day cure period to fix the violations of store operating standards but according to him, the legal department decided to promptly terminate his franchise agreement instead.</p></blockquote>
<p>In retribution, it seems, Agnello has turned his former restaurant into a strip club (called Cousin Vinny&#8217;s Little Secret) that offers both subs and lap dances.  According to the text of Vinny&#8217;s promotional flyer, posted on <a href="http://gawker.com/tag/hot-spots/?i=394248&amp;t=visit-cousin-vinnys-strippers+and+sandwiches-club-tonight">gossip blogsite Gawker</a> , includes reference to his Subway franchise:  &#8220;Cannot remember our phone number? Simply call information for the number to the Subway Restaurant on East Tremont Avenue in the Bronx! Hope to see you soon!&#8221;</p>
<p>&#8220;Cousin Vinny&#8221;  Agnello and Doctor&#8217;s Associates, Inc. are currently in arbitration to end a relationship that, in the end, will waste the time and money of all involved.</p>
